http://v2.retinatoday.com/business-matters/article.asp?article=icd-10-coding-for-uveitis WebUveitis is a general term used to describe a group of diseases that cause red eyes, eye pain and inflammation. These diseases typically affect the uvea, the eye’s middle layer. They can also affect other parts of the eye. If not treated, uveitis can cause permanent blindness or vision loss. WebAug 1, 2008 · Think horses, not zebras. The basic workup for an anterior uveitis includes an HLA-B27, RPR, FTA-Abs, CXR and Lyme Ab, depending on geographic location. The utility of obtaining an ACE is debated among uveitis specialists because of the many factors impacting the level. Acute uveitis is characterized by sudden onset (over hours or days) and limited duration (≤3 months' duration). In recurrent uveitis, there are repeated episodes separated by disease inactivity ≥3 months, whether on or off treatment.
